WebMar 20, 2024 · Death Valley is the largest U.S. National Park outside Alaska at 3,422,024 acres. Nearly 1,000 miles of paved and dirt roads provide access to locations both popular and remote. WebMay 3, 2024 · Here are your options: The private vehicle entrance fee, good for 7 days, is $30. This makes sense if you have more than one day at Death Valley and plan to drive in or out several times; even if you’re only visiting for one day, you’ll need to pay this fee. You can walk into the park for $15 per person, good for 7 days. WebStroll Across Badwater Basin. Among the top things to do in Death Valley National Park is Badwater Basin. At 282 feet below sea level, this is the lowest point in North America. Badwater Basin is so low because a fault line runs through Death Valley that makes the valley floor drop. Web2. You can’t beat the heat at Death Valley. Free shipping for many products! bini the bunny paintingWebThe best time to visit Death Valley is from November to March. Winter, from December to February, is generally a mild and sunny season, although sometimes it can rain, or it can get a little cold (especially in December and January).
